As the anticipation builds for the 2025 MLS All-Star Game at Austin’s Q2 Stadium, a storm is brewing around one of soccer’s biggest names: Lionel Messi. The Inter Miami superstar, selected as one of the 26 elite players for the MLS All-Star Team, has sent shockwaves through the soccer world by missing the team’s first training session ahead of Wednesday’s highly anticipated match. Alongside teammate Jordi Alba, Messi’s absence has sparked heated debate, with fans and analysts speculating about a potential suspension that could see him sidelined for Inter Miami’s next clash against FC Cincinnati.

According to MLS rules, players selected for the All-Star Game who skip the event without a valid reason—such as an injury—face a one-game suspension in the regular season. With Inter Miami set to face FC Cincinnati on Saturday at Chase Stadium, the stakes couldn’t be higher. Messi, who missed last year’s All-Star Game due to an ankle injury sustained in the 2024 Copa América final, now finds himself at the center of a similar controversy. A Precedent Set by Zlatan

This isn’t the first time an MLS star has faced scrutiny for skipping the All-Star Game. In 2018, Zlatan Ibrahimović, then with the LA Galaxy, made headlines when he opted out of the event, citing the grueling schedule of three games in seven days. Despite issuing a public statement, the Swedish striker couldn’t escape the consequences and was slapped with a one-game suspension, missing LA Galaxy’s subsequent match against Juventus. Ibrahimović’s case serves as a stark reminder that the MLS doesn’t shy away from enforcing its regulations, even on its biggest stars.
